Digital Marketing Video ads


Video ads for digital marketing are an effective way to captivate and interact with your target audience. These succinct, eye-catching videos take advantage of the widespread use of online video platforms to successfully communicate your brand's message. Video advertisements provide a succinct but effective means of conveying important information in light of people's short attention spans.


Visual Appeal: Creative storytelling through images is made possible by video advertisements, which facilitate the effective demonstration of goods and services and the communication of emotions. Visuals and graphics of the highest calibre are essential for grabbing the attention of viewers in the first few seconds.


Platform Diversity: Video advertisements can be customised to fit a variety of platforms, including social media, websites, and streaming services. Making sure your message is appropriate for the target audience on each platform may necessitate using a different approach to content creation.


Targeted Reach: You can reach a particular audience segment or demographic by using the advanced targeting options offered by digital marketing platforms. Your video advertisements will be seen by people who are most likely to be interested in your product or service thanks to this focused approach.

Measurable Outcomes: Digital marketing video ads provide in-depth analytics, in contrast to traditional advertising. Views, click-through rates, and conversion metrics are all trackable, giving you important information about how well your campaign is working. This data-driven strategy makes ongoing optimization possible.


Possibilities for Storytelling: Video advertisements offer a stage for powerful narratives. You can establish a relationship with your audience by using a story, anecdote, or example. A compelling narrative can boost brand recall and make an impression that lasts.


Mobile Optimisation: Video advertisements are made to be viewed on mobile devices, as this is how most internet users access content. Short, eye-catching videos are ideal for consumers who are always on the go and prefer content that is quick to watch and easy to digest.
